Asteroids: Rollage (100,000+)

 

I was hoping to end the game at 99,990, but at 99,950, a saucer appeared and hit the 20 point large asteroid I shot at, causing me to hit a 50 point asteroid instead, rolling the score.

 

@Vocelli, I would recommend setting rollage to 99,000 for this game.

 

My strategy is to clear the right half of the screen first since the game seems to place your ship slightly to the right and it seems like you can blast away asteroids faster to the right than to the left.  If you shoot straight to the right, your shot barely wraps around the screen, but if you shoot straight left, you may miss an asteroid at the edge.  Once the right side is clear, then I aim for whatever is heading my way and try to take down the saucers when they appear. 

 

When the board has only a few asteroids or you're trying to hit a saucer, be patient and don't fire until you have a clear shot.  You can only have two shots on the screen at once, so if you miss with both shots, you have to wait for one of your shots to leave the screen before being able to shoot again.

 

I never use the thrust and always just stay in the middle of the screen.  I don't hunt saucers since I'm not very good at this technique and I found it to be more risky than just blasting away at the asteroids.  I prefer when the saucers appear when the screen is full of asteroids which act as a shield from their fire.

It's not the 7800.  The same collision issues happen on the 2600.  I died a few times by taking down my shield a little too soon a few times, even though I should have been clear of the asteroid.  It took me awhile to get used to this timing.

 

I also had sometimes issues getting the fire button to respond.  I'm not sure if it's the game or if my joystick is wearing out.  I guess I'll find out when I start playing another game.
